I am sure advertising as such is not allowed on the forum so this is just to invite all who are interested to the launch for the Edinburgh Airport History book on Friday 21st April at 12.00 lunchtime. I have already been in touch with people who have helped me on the forum directly but all are welcome.
It will be at Books Etc on the mezzanine in the terminal. Food is not allowed due to health and safety regulations but there will be wine tea coffee laid on (I will lay in a couple of bottles of white lightning for the more discerning drinker).
I will be there most of the day as will Len Houston who wrote the section in the book on the Ferranti Flying Unit and provided most of the pictures for it. Len is the former Chief Test Pilot for the FFU and we both look forward to saying hello to everyone.
